Top tips for finding Oroville hotel deals

  • If you’re looking for a cheap hotel in Oroville, you should consider visiting during the low season. You'll find cheaper accommodations in Oroville in July and September.
  • Hotel room prices vary depending on many factors but you’ll most likely find the best hotel deals in Oroville if you stay on a Saturday. The opposite is true for, Tuesday, which is usually the most expensive day.
  • Tourists visiting Oroville, California, to enjoy the museums in the city should consider residing in hotels close to the venues. Days Inn by Wyndham Oroville is a great place to stay as you’ll easily access the Bath House Museum & Feather River Nature Center/ Native Plant Park, which is about 1.7 miles away.
  • Oroville is home to some of the city’s top nightlife spots. Suppose you’d like to explore some, if not all, the venues; consider staying near Bird Street at Super 8 by Wyndham Oroville. The hotel offers a convenient spot close to The Villa Vino, Nori Asian Kitchen & Sushi, Union, Monday Club, and Gattaca Bar & Grill, among many others.
  • Some visitors in Oroville, California, desire to stay in affordable hotels in the city. The city has several affordable hotels you can book yourself into if you want to spend less. Sunset Inn Lake Oroville, Custom Home all to Yourself, and Villa Court Inn Oroville are excellent picks to help you save money. They have amazing rooms with all the essential amenities for a comfortable stay.
  • Those visiting Oroville, California, with children should think about finding a hotel that can accommodate them comfortably. Lodge At Feather Falls Casino is your go-to hotel if you are in the city with children. They feature large pools children love, free internet, and spacious rooms.
  • Newlyweds in the city looking for a hotel to celebrate their honeymoon can consider booking their stay at Holiday Inn Express Hotel & Suites Oroville Lake, An IHG Hotel. The hotel is located off Highway 70 and is close to an array of great dining and drinking spots. Additionally, it has a heated indoor pool and whirlpool for maximum comfort.
